OLD guitars and forgotten pianos are set to make a return when a “new community jam” session begins next month.

Catch Music co-ordinator Tim Roberton said thousands list music and making music as a favourite hobby.

“The trouble is, just like other things in life, you sometimes need a little group motivation to get you started,” he said.

“Then once you’re playing and in the middle of it, you really love it.”

The initiative came from two local community groups, Catch Music and the Lost Generation Project.

Mr Roberton said the idea behind the Melville jam session was to create a space for local amateur musicians to meet like-minded people, have fun and brush up their skills.

“All ages, skill levels, instruments and singers are welcome,” he said.

The first session will be on Wednesday July 8 from 7pm at the Vault Youth Centre in Melville. For more information, visit www. catchmusic.org.au or call Tim on 0430 589 369.
